On Tue, Aug 04, 2026 at 08:27:03PM -0600, James Hilliard wrote:
> The AC300 exposes its Fast Ethernet PHY control registers through a
> separate non-PHY Clause 22 address. The manual defines that address as
> the link PHY address plus 16, giving control addresses 16 through 23 and
> link addresses 0 through 7.

That's not a separate device, but just a second address range. You 
should make 'reg' have 2 entries.

> 
> Describe the control endpoint, its required VCC1 supply, its 24, 25 or
> 27 MHz input clock and its SoC SID calibration cell. The actual PHY
> remains a separate ethernet-phy node and supplies the MAC-selected
> interface mode at runtime.

> +description:
> +  The AC300 Fast Ethernet PHY has a separate control interface accessed as a
> +  non-PHY Clause 22 device. Its address is 16 plus the address of the link PHY.
> +
> +properties:
> +  compatible:
> +    const: x-powers,ac300-ephy-ctl
> +
> +  reg:
> +    minimum: 16
> +    maximum: 23
> +
> +  clocks:
> +    maxItems: 1
> +    description:
> +      AC300 input clock. Its configured rate must be 24, 25, or 27 MHz and
> +      determines the corresponding EPHY_CLK_SEL value.
> +
> +  vcc1-supply:
> +    description:
> +      3.3 V supply for the AC300 I/O, bandgap, Ethernet PHY analog front end,
> +      and internal digital LDO

Sounds like this supply and clock would need to be enabled before 
accessing the "link PHY address"? If so, then 2 nodes is really a 
problem.
